1. Vertical Gardens
If you have limited space, vertical gardens are a great way to maximize your planting area. Wooden pallets can be mounted on walls or fences and filled with soil to grow flowers, herbs, or even vegetables.

2. Raised Garden Beds
Pallets can be deconstructed and repurposed into raised garden beds. These beds help improve soil drainage and keep weeds at bay, making them perfect for growing vegetables or flowers.

3. Garden Benches
Craft a rustic yet stylish bench using wooden pallets. With some sanding, staining, and cushioning, you can create a cozy seating area for relaxation in your garden.

4. Outdoor Tables
A sturdy outdoor table made from pallets is perfect for entertaining guests. You can customize the size and finish to match your garden’s aesthetic.

5. Hanging Planters
Convert pallets into hanging planters by attaching small pots or creating built-in compartments for plants. Hang them from fences, pergolas, or walls for a unique touch.

6. Compost Bins
Use wooden pallets to construct an eco-friendly compost bin. The slatted design allows for proper airflow, which speeds up the composting process.

7. Garden Pathways
Cut pallets into planks and lay them out as a garden pathway. This creates a rustic, natural walkway while preventing muddy patches in your garden.

8. Trellises for Climbing Plants
Support climbing plants such as roses, ivy, or beans by repurposing pallets into trellises. Simply stand the pallet upright and secure it in place.

9. Storage Racks for Tools
Keep your gardening tools organized by transforming a pallet into a tool rack. Mount it on a shed wall or fence for easy access to shovels, rakes, and other essentials.

10. Pallet Swings
For a fun and relaxing addition to your garden, turn a pallet into a swing. Hang it from a sturdy tree branch or a pergola to create a charming outdoor retreat.

11. Outdoor Bar or Serving Station
Host outdoor gatherings with a pallet bar or serving station. Add shelves for storage and a countertop for preparing and serving drinks.

12. Birdhouses and Bird Feeders
Welcome feathered friends to your garden by building DIY birdhouses and feeders from wooden pallets.

13. Garden Signs and Decor
Personalize your garden with handcrafted pallet signs. Paint inspirational quotes or label different plant beds for a decorative touch.

14. Fence or Privacy Screen
Stack and secure pallets together to form a privacy screen or garden fence. It’s an affordable and stylish way to section off areas of your garden.

15. Firewood Storage Rack
Keep your firewood neatly stacked and dry with a pallet storage rack. The slatted design promotes airflow to prevent wood from rotting.

16. Kids’ Playhouse or Sandbox
Build a small playhouse or sandbox for kids using wooden pallets. This DIY project offers a fun and budget-friendly play area.

17. Greenhouse Frames
Use pallets as frames for a small greenhouse. Attach clear plastic sheets or old windows to create a warm environment for plants in colder months.

18. Wall-Mounted Herb Gardens
Save space by converting a pallet into a wall-mounted herb garden. It’s perfect for growing basil, mint, rosemary, and other kitchen essentials.

19. Candle or Lantern Holders
Add ambiance to your garden by crafting pallet candle holders or lantern stands. These rustic accents create a cozy atmosphere for outdoor evenings.

20. Outdoor Shelving Units
Store gardening supplies, potted plants, or decorative pieces on a pallet shelving unit. It helps keep your space tidy while adding character.
